Why Use a Starter Template Instead of Building from Scratch? 

So we start with the basics and understand what starter templates are. Basically, you can consider them as a pre-designed website or as a page layout that can be imported to WordPress.

The templates offer ready-made designs for key pages such as homepages, about pages, contact forms, service pages, and more.

Instead of building from scratch, users can import a polished design and customize it using popular page builders like Elementor and Gutenberg.

These templates are easier to integrate with WordPress themes and offer a flexible layout and style to the site. Users can also mix and match different templates to build a unique website that fits their brand or business.

The Global setting options include (you will get these options as long as the Responsive theme is activated):

  1. Layout: This section typically allows you to control the overall structure and arrangement of your website. This could include container Width, sidebar layout, content spacing, or header and footer layouts. This setting makes your site look sleek.
  1. Buttons: This section is where you would define the default styling for all buttons across your website. This ensures consistency and saves you from styling each button individually. Options here usually include background color (normal & hover), text color, border radius, and padding.
  1. Form Fields: This controls the default appearance of input fields in forms (e.g., contact forms, search bars, comment sections) across your site. This helps keep all interactive elements looking consistent. You can change the border color, background color, text color, and more.
  1. Colors & Backgrounds: This section is essential for setting your website’s main color scheme. It even provides color presets that make it easy for you to work, or you can even select the color that you want. Setting the primary color, accent, text, and background all at once, which can be controlled from one place.
  1. Typography: This section allows you to control the fonts used across your entire website, ensuring a consistent and professional typographic hierarchy. In this, you also get the preset for fonts to choose from, or you can typically set: Base Font, Heading Fonts (H1, H2, H3…), and Font Size.
  1. Social Links: This likely provides options to easily add and customize links to your social media profiles (e.g., Facebook, Twitter, Instagram). 
  1. Embed Scripts: This is the advanced setting that allows you to add custom code to the header and footer. It is there for tracking, analytics, or third-party integrations. This could include Google Analytics tracking code, Facebook Pixel, and Custom JavaScript or CSS.

Step 5: Add/Remove Pages or Sections 

To add a new page or post to your website, navigate to the Pages or Posts section in your WordPress dashboard and click on Add New.

To delete a page or post, select the checkbox next to the item you want to remove, choose Move to Trash from the Bulk Actions dropdown, and then click Apply.
